We just hung some border and did exactly what the directions stated. The bottom edge of the border is now coming up in quite a few places. I've read this thread quite a bit and now realize that we should of use some paste along with the border's own paste. Oh well, it's that "hind-sight" thing again! What do we do now? I really don't want to remove the border so is there a way to just paste the edges that are coming up? if it's sticking pretty good except for just those edges, you can leave it up and just get some border adhesive. either squirt some under the loose edges or use a little paint brush to get some glue up under the edge. use a squeegy or smoother to get out any air bubbles, but don't press so hard as to squeegy out all the glue! then you should be fine.
